Poggiotondo Chianti Classico 2016 shows bright garnet color with a core of ripe red cherry and cranberry fruit framed by a ribbon of dried herbs and Tuscan scrub. The nose opens to floral lift—dried rose and violet—alongside sweet spice and a touch of tobacco that adds savory complexity.
On the palate it’s medium-bodied with vivid acidity and fine-grained tannins that carry flavors of sour cherry, dried fig and a mineral-tinged finish. The overall balance and clarity of Sangiovese make it reminiscent of classic, food-friendly Chianti Classico from a strong 2016 vintage.
Serve slightly below room temperature with tomato-based pasta, roast pork or aged pecorino.
